Summary

Maurice O'Donnell, a 48‑year pigeon‑racing veteran from Dungarvan, secured a temporary High Court injunction that bars the Irish Homing Union (IHU) Southern Region and its Management Committee from suspending his membership of the Irish Homing Union National Flying Club. O'Donnell claims he was suspended without notice or explanation, and that the suspension breaches IHU rules and harms him personally. The injunction, granted ex‑parte by Mr Justice Paul Gilligan, also prevents the defendants from holding a meeting about the suspension or related matters. O'Donnell has previously served on the club's Management Committee, resigned after disputes over disciplining a member and over the use of fundraiser money, and has been involved in disputes over alleged threats. He was briefly reinstated in March, elected club President, but the suspension was reinstated in April without reasons, affecting his ability to race pigeons. The case is set for a return hearing next week.
